Self Healing is the Doorway to Our Joy
by Maureen Higgins

Healing ourselves is the key to experiencing our inner light, thus, our joy. When our inner light is able to shine through, we automatically help shift our earth and all earth's inhabitants because of our interconnectedness.

We are all connected, because we are made of God or Golden Light. However, we all have challenges in our lives that make it difficult to feel, experience and emit our Golden Light. Our challenges are within us, and they attract those experiences and people to help us look at our unhelpful beliefs, thoughts and attitudes that manifest themselves as mental chatter, held-in emotions and physical symptoms.

We each have an energetic grid around us (in our auric field) made up of various shapes correlating with numbers that attract energies of the same nature. For example, if our soul wants to learn trust, our grid is arranged in a pattern designed to attract situations giving us the opportunity to trust ourselves and others.

If we pay attention, our mental chatter will give us hints as to what is blocking us from trusting. Our mental chatter may include statements such as, "I'm afraid people won't like me if they know me too well," or "People always let me down." We may be able to get in touch with our mental chatter by ourselves through meditation (observing our thought patterns), free association (speaking out loud and allowing any thoughts to come out without monitoring them), and journaling. Sometimes just knowing which unhelpful beliefs are a part of our consciousness can help release them.

If we allow ourselves to experience our emotions, we may get in touch with what is blocking us from trust. We may realize that "we haven't allowed people to get close, because we're still holding onto a grudge with Aunt Gertrude." Our emotions may flow freely through meditation (we may be given a flashback that triggers us to cry) or through our daily lives (a situation may remind us of the original sadness, thus causing us to cry).

Our body may hurt letting us know that something is bothering us. If we meditate on the painful area, our body may tell us what is causing the pain, which can release it. Sometimes our pain can be so severe that it is difficult to relax enough to get in touch with the underlying cause. Then it can be helpful to work exclusively with the body until it feels strong enough to understand the core issues to its pain.

When mental, emotional, and physical patterns are deeply ingrained, they may need outside assistance. Guided imagery works well in uncovering and transforming unhelpful patterns. Your mind can fully relax while you are gently guided towards your inner answers. Inner answers are not discovered using your mind -- insights come from the heart.

The heart is in alignment with the soul, which knows what is needed in your life to help you spiritually evolve and experience inner freedom. With proper guidance, your heart can zero in on what is causing mental stress, emotional difficulties and physical symptoms. As your heart finds answers to your challenges, statements of intent and energy work help transform your inner energy patterns, re-pattern your auric energetic grid, thus elevating mental, emotional and physical symptoms. Re-patterning allows you to feel lighter inside and attract situations and people to your life that further your spiritual growth.

We don't want to judge ourselves by saying, "Since I'm sick, I must've done something wrong." Everyone has inner challenges or pains, which are really stepping stones to wisdom and spiritual growth -- so they're gifts. Our belief systems, thoughts and attitudes create our pain (thus our reality), yet experiencing and walking through our pain allows us to understand ourselves and develop compassion, understanding and love so we may experience our Golden Light.
